About this map

White River meanders through this landscape on the border of Woodruff and White Counties, defining a floodplain dense with oxbows and cypress-lined breaks. The river’s winding course is marked by landmarks like Panther Point and numerous sloughs, including Out-off Slough and Goose Pond Slough. To the south, the Hurricane Lake State Game Area encompasses a labyrinth of water bodies such as Big Clear Lake, Little Clear Lake, and Bollie Pond, illustrating the complex hydrology of the Arkansas bottomlands.
